At Redcar Central, ticket purchasing and collection is made easy with a ticket office that operates from 07:05 to 13:30 on weekdays and ticket machines available for cash and card transactions. For those planning to collect tickets bought online, you'll find convenient machines ready for use. The station also accommodates passengers with hearing impairments via an induction loop system. While the station lacks waiting rooms, there’s a seating area, ensuring you have a cozy spot to sit.
Step-free access is partially available, with a level crossing allowing entry to both platforms. However, moving between platforms might require a little patience as level transfer is possible but lengthy, urging careful planning especially for those with mobility challenges. As for your safety, CCTV is in place throughout the premises. However, remember that there are no accessible taxi services directly from the station.
If you’re heading to the station by car, you’ll find parking easily available with 60 spaces at your disposal, including one specifically for accessible parking. Bicycle enthusiasts will appreciate the 16 bicycle storage spaces, featuring a mix of lockers and stands, catering to varied storage needs.
Redcar Central perfectly interlinks with various transport modalities, ensuring seamless connectivity. For bus services, you can head to the bus stop right at the front of the station, with Busline available at 0871 200 2233 for more information. If you find yourself in need of a taxi, make use of the Cab4You service to arrange a ride with just a few clicks. In cases of rail service interruptions, rail replacement services can be accessed nearby on Westdyke Road.

While Highbury & Islington station doesn't boast a traditional ticket office, it offers ticket machines for your convenience. These machines include accessible ticket options suitable for the London Underground, providing ease of use for all passengers. While there is no facility to collect tickets bought online, the presence of an induction loop ensures accessibility for those with hearing impairments.
The station is fully equipped with CCTV for safety, although it lacks amenities such as accessible toilets and a dedicated waiting room. The platforms are partially covered, offering some respite from the elements. Additionally, while refreshment facilities and a newsagent are available, there are no ATM machines or luggage storage facilities on site.
Highbury & Islington station is committed to being accessible, featuring step-free access throughout most of the station. Lifts connect the ticket hall to London Overground platforms. However, it's important to note that step-free access is not available for Great Northern services or the London Underground Victoria line. Assistance is available and can be pre-booked, ensuring all travelers can navigate the station comfortably.
When it comes to travel connections, Highbury & Islington is exceedingly well-connected. The station provides easy links through the London Underground's Victoria Line, making it a seamless transfer point for those heading to key areas. For those looking to catch a bus, Highbury & Islington features connections on Holloway Road, and more detailed routes and destinations can be discovered through TfL's interactive map. The station is also a gateway for travelers heading to Stansted Airport via Tottenham Hale, ensuring those with flights can reach their destination with ease.
